Venezuelan President Nicolas Maduro lands in New York

From ABC News.

Venezuelan President Nicolas Maduro arrived in New York after he and his wife were captured during a U.S. strike on Venezuela.

Maduro is now expected to take a helicopter to New York City, accompanied by the DEA. He will then head by motorcade to a location in New York City for processing before he’s held in jail, sources said.